Researchers have developed DifFoundMAD, a new framework for detecting morphed digital images, particularly for applications like border control. This system leverages vision foundation models to identify discrepancies between suspected morphed images and live capture images. By fine-tuning a small subset of parameters, DifFoundMAD significantly reduces error rates compared to existing methods, achieving a reduction from 6.16% to 2.17% at high-security levels. AI
